But what exactly are autoresponders, and why are they crucial for your WordPress site?

Autoresponders are automated email systems designed to send pre-scheduled messages to your subscribers based on specific triggers or actions. These could range from a simple welcome email to a series of follow-up messages aimed at nurturing leads. By leveraging autoresponders, you save time while maintaining consistent communication with your audience, ultimately driving higher engagement and conversions.

WordPress, being one of the most popular content management systems, offers numerous plugins and integrations that make it easy to add autoresponders to your site. Whether you are a blogger, an e-commerce store owner, or a service provider, autoresponders can help you build stronger relationships with your audience, keep them informed about your offerings, and guide them through your sales funnel.

Benefits of Using Autoresponders

Utilizing autoresponders on your WordPress site can provide a multitude of benefits that directly impact the efficiency and effectiveness of your email marketing strategy. Here are some of the key advantages:

  • Time-Saving Automation: One of the most significant benefits of autoresponders is the ability to automate repetitive tasks. By setting up a series of pre-scheduled emails, you can ensure that your audience receives timely and relevant information without the need for manual intervention.
  • Improved Engagement: Autoresponders allow you to send targeted messages based on user actions, such as signing up for a newsletter or making a purchase. This personalized approach can significantly enhance user engagement and build stronger relationships with your subscribers.
  • Consistent Communication: Maintaining regular communication with your audience is crucial for building trust and loyalty. Autoresponders help you stay in touch with your subscribers consistently, ensuring that they are always up-to-date with your latest content, offers, and announcements.
  • Lead Nurturing: By sending a series of well-timed follow-up emails, autoresponders can guide potential customers through your sales funnel, providing them with the information they need to make informed purchasing decisions. This nurturing process can lead to higher conversion rates and increased sales.
  • Scalability: As your business grows, managing email communications manually can become increasingly challenging. Autoresponders offer a scalable solution that can handle a large volume of subscribers, allowing you to focus on other critical aspects of your business.
  • Analytics and Optimization: Most autoresponder tools come with built-in analytics that provide insights into the performance of your email campaigns. By analyzing metrics such as open rates, click-through rates, and conversions, you can continuously optimize your email strategy for better results.

Incorporating autoresponders into your WordPress site can revolutionize your email marketing efforts, making them more efficient, effective, and scalable. By leveraging these automated tools, you can ensure that your audience receives timely and relevant communications, ultimately driving higher engagement and conversions.

Top Features to Look For

When selecting an autoresponder for your WordPress site, it’s essential to consider the features that will best support your email marketing goals. Here are some top features to look for:

  • Easy Integration: Ensure the autoresponder integrates seamlessly with WordPress and other tools you are using. This includes plugins, e-commerce platforms, and CRM systems, allowing for a smooth workflow and unified data management.
  • Drag-and-Drop Email Builder: A user-friendly, drag-and-drop email builder enables you to create professional and visually appealing emails without any coding knowledge. Look for customizable templates that can be tailored to fit your brand’s aesthetic.
  • Automation Workflows: Advanced automation capabilities are crucial for setting up complex email sequences based on user behavior and triggers. Features like conditional logic and branching workflows can help you create more personalized and effective email campaigns.
  • Segmentation and Personalization: The ability to segment your email list based on various criteria (e.g., demographics, purchase history, engagement level) and personalize your messages can significantly improve engagement rates. Look for tools that allow dynamic content and personalized subject lines.
  • Analytics and Reporting: Comprehensive analytics and reporting features are vital for measuring the success of your email campaigns. Look for autoresponders that offer detailed insights into open rates, click-through rates, conversion rates, and other key metrics.
  • A/B Testing: A/B testing capabilities enable you to experiment with different subject lines, email content, and send times to determine what resonates best with your audience. This can help optimize your campaigns for better performance.
  • Compliance and Deliverability: Ensure that the autoresponder complies with email marketing regulations such as GDPR and CAN-SPAM. Additionally, look for features that enhance deliverability, such as spam score checks and sender reputation management.

Prioritizing these features when choosing an autoresponder for your WordPress site will help you create more effective and engaging email campaigns. By leveraging the right tools, you can streamline your email marketing efforts and achieve better results.

Best Autoresponders for WordPress

Finding the best autoresponders for WordPress can significantly enhance your email marketing strategy. Below are some of the top choices that offer powerful features and seamless integration with WordPress:

  • Mailchimp: Known for its robust features and ease of use, Mailchimp offers a WordPress plugin that allows for easy integration. It provides a comprehensive email builder, automation workflows, segmentation, and detailed analytics.
  • Aweber: Aweber is a popular choice among small businesses for its simplicity and effectiveness. It offers a WordPress plugin to integrate sign-up forms and manage subscribers directly from your site. Aweber also provides powerful automation tools, A/B testing, and extensive reporting.
  • ConvertKit: Tailored for content creators, ConvertKit is excellent for bloggers and online creators who need advanced automation features. It integrates smoothly with WordPress through various plugins and offers features like visual automation builder, tagging, and segmentation.
  • GetResponse: With extensive marketing automation capabilities, GetResponse is suitable for businesses of all sizes. It includes a WordPress plugin for easy integration, a drag-and-drop email builder, CRM features, and robust analytics.
  • ActiveCampaign: ActiveCampaign offers advanced marketing automation and CRM features, making it a great choice for businesses looking to scale. The WordPress plugin facilitates form and contact management, and the platform provides in-depth analytics and segmentation options.
  • Sendinblue: Sendinblue is known for its affordability and feature-rich platform. It integrates with WordPress via a plugin and offers email marketing, SMS marketing, automation workflows, and transactional emails. Its user-friendly interface makes it accessible for beginners and advanced users alike.

Each of these autoresponders offers unique features that can cater to different business needs. Depending on your specific requirements, choosing the right autoresponder for your WordPress site can help you streamline your email marketing efforts and achieve your goals more effectively.

How to Integrate Autoresponders with WordPress

Integrating autoresponders with WordPress is a straightforward process that can greatly enhance your email marketing efforts. Here’s a step-by-step guide to help you get started:

  1. Choose Your Autoresponder: First, select an autoresponder that best fits your needs. Popular choices include Mailchimp, Aweber, ConvertKit, GetResponse, ActiveCampaign, and Sendinblue. Each of these tools offers unique features and different levels of integration with WordPress.
  2. Install the Plugin: Most autoresponders offer a dedicated WordPress plugin. Go to your WordPress dashboard, navigate to the Plugins section, and click on Add New. Search for the plugin associated with your chosen autoresponder and click Install Now, then activate the plugin.
  3. Connect Your Account: After activating the plugin, you’ll need to connect it to your autoresponder account. This usually involves entering an API key or authorization code, which you can find in your autoresponder’s account settings. Follow the plugin’s instructions to complete this step.
  4. Create and Embed Forms: Once connected, you can start creating subscription forms. Most plugins offer a form builder or shortcode that you can customize and embed on your site. Place these forms on high-traffic areas like your homepage, blog posts, or landing pages to capture more leads.
  5. Set Up Automation: Take advantage of automation features by setting up welcome emails, follow-ups, and drip campaigns. Most autoresponders offer easy-to-use automation builders that allow you to create workflows based on user actions.
  6. Monitor and Optimize: After everything is set up, monitor your email campaigns and form performance through the analytics provided by your autoresponder. Make adjustments as needed to improve open rates, click-through rates, and overall engagement.

By following these steps, you can seamlessly integrate an autoresponder with your WordPress site, allowing you to automate your email marketing efforts and focus on growing your business.

Tips for Maximizing Autoresponder Efficiency

To truly harness the power of autoresponders for your WordPress site, it’s crucial to maximize their efficiency. Here are some tips to help you get the most out of your email marketing efforts:

  1. Segment Your Audience: Tailor your messages by segmenting your email list based on behaviors, preferences, and demographics. This ensures that your subscribers receive content that is relevant to their interests, increasing engagement and conversion rates.
  2. Personalize Your Emails: Use personalization tokens to address subscribers by their first name and include personalized recommendations based on their past interactions. Personalization makes your emails feel more like one-on-one communications rather than generic blasts.
  3. Optimize Your Subject Lines: Craft compelling subject lines that grab attention and entice recipients to open your emails. Keep them short, intriguing, and relevant to the content inside.
  4. Test and Refine: Perform A/B testing on various email elements such as subject lines, content, call-to-action buttons, and sending times. Analyzing the results will help you understand what works best for your audience and optimize your campaigns accordingly.
  5. Maintain a Consistent Schedule: Consistency is key to keeping your audience engaged. Establish a regular sending schedule and stick to it, whether it’s a weekly newsletter, monthly update, or special promotions.
  6. Monitor Performance Metrics: Keep an eye on your open rates, click-through rates, and conversion rates. Use these metrics to identify strengths and weaknesses in your campaigns, allowing you to make data-driven improvements.

By implementing these strategies, you can significantly improve the efficiency of your autoresponders, resulting in higher engagement and better overall performance of your email marketing campaigns.
